When a truck ABS system is described as 6S/4M configured,how many modulator valves are used in the system?
A) 6
B) 4
C) 2
D) 1
Modulator Valves
Valves that modulate the pressure of fluids in systems such as automatic transmissions and ABS braking systems, for controlled operation.

Final Answer :
B
Explanation :
The "6S/4M" configuration in a truck ABS system indicates that there are 6 sensors and 4 modulator valves.
